The Role of Hygienic Rubber Flooring in Infection Control
Maintaining a sterile environment is the cornerstone of patient safety. Standard vinyl or linoleum can sometimes become porous over time, but high-density Hygienic Rubber Flooring is naturally non-absorbent. This means that biological spills which are inevitable in a clinical setting cannot penetrate the surface. When combined with proper heat-welded seams, rubber creates a monolithic surface that is exceptionally easy to disinfect with hospital-grade cleaning agents without the risk of material degradation.
Beyond cleanliness, the tactile nature of rubber provides a level of comfort that aids in patient recovery. Hard, reflective surfaces can create a loud, echoing environment that increases patient stress and disrupts sleep. Rubber naturally dampens the sound of footsteps, rolling carts, and dropped items. This acoustic buffering creates a quieter, more peaceful atmosphere, which is statistically linked to faster recovery times and better overall patient outcomes in long-term care facilities.
Safety and Durability in High-Traffic Healthcare Zones
Fall prevention is a critical metric for any healthcare provider. The natural traction of Rubber Flooring provides a consistent, anti-slip surface even when moisture is present. For elderly patients or those in rehabilitation, the slight "give" of the material offers better underfoot stability compared to polished stone or laminate. If a fall does occur, the impact absorption of a high-quality rubber compound can significantly reduce the severity of injuries, providing a vital safety net in high-risk wards.
Durability in a hospital setting is measured by decades, not years. The intense cleaning schedules and constant movement of heavy machinery can quickly wear down inferior materials. Premium rubber is vulcanized to resist scuffing and chemical staining. This resilience ensures that the floor maintains its professional, clean appearance despite the rigors of 24/7 operation. By choosing a material that does not require frequent stripping, waxing, or buffing, healthcare facilities also benefit from reduced long-term maintenance costs and less operational downtime.

How does rubber flooring contribute to hospital infection control?
Hygienic Rubber Flooring is fundamentally non-porous, meaning it does not have the microscopic pores that trap bacteria, viruses, and fungi in other materials. Because it can be installed with seamless, heat-welded joints, there are no grout lines or gaps for pathogens to colonize. This makes it significantly easier to achieve deep-level sterilization using standard hospital disinfectants, which is essential for preventing healthcare-associated infections (HAIs) and protecting vulnerable patients in a clinical ward.
Is rubber flooring suitable for heavy medical equipment and beds?
Yes, rubber flooring for patient room use is specifically engineered to have high point-load resistance. This ensures that the heavy wheels of bariatric beds, portable X-ray machines, and oxygen tanks do not leave permanent "dimples" or indentations in the floor. The vulcanization process during manufacturing creates a dense molecular structure that recovers its shape after the weight is moved, maintaining a perfectly level surface that is vital for both safety and the easy transport of rolling medical equipment.
How does this material improve the acoustic environment of a ward?
One of the most overlooked benefits of rubber is its natural sound-dampening properties. In a busy hospital, the clatter of hard-soled shoes and the hum of rolling carts on hard floors can create a noisy environment that hinders patient rest. Rubber absorbs impact noise and reduces sound transmission between floors. By lowering the ambient decibel levels, it helps create a "healing silence" that reduces staff fatigue and allows patients to sleep more soundly, which is a key component of the recovery process.
Can rubber flooring withstand frequent chemical cleaning?
Healthcare floors are subjected to some of the harshest cleaning chemicals in the industry, including bleach and specialized antimicrobial solutions. High-quality rubber is chemically inert and resistant to the vast majority of these agents. Unlike vinyl, which may require periodic waxing or sealing to maintain its protective layer, rubber maintains its integrity throughout its lifespan. This chemical resistance ensures that the floor will not become brittle, discolored, or slippery even after years of intensive daily sterilization cycles.
